Transaction costs hit at the very beginning. From one market to another, the costs typically include transfer tax or stamp duty, notarial charges, land registry charges, the cost of legal advice and the agent's commission. As a working assumption, set aside a noticeable share above the purchase price, and verify the actual local figures.


Yearly taxes on the property in budva come next. Rates vary enormously, and some countries charge different rates depending on residency. If the home stands vacant most of the time, vacancy taxes can apply.


Community fees catch buyers out. A flat in a development with shared gardens, a lift and a concierge carries monthly costs that continue whether you are there or not. Obtain the building's financial records before signing, and look for scheduled repairs.

Insurance, utility standing charges and exit costs complete the picture. Tax on the sale can apply when a non-resident sells, and the resident rate is not always the one that applies. A good discipline is to build a simple long-term cost projection at the offer stage — the total tends to exceed what the buyer imagined.
